The French and Italian studies major offers a dual focus for students passionate about both cultures and languages. This interdisciplinary program examines key literary works from each country while investigating the historical connections and cultural exchanges that have shaped French and Italian traditions. Through this comparative approach, students gain exposure to diverse cultural perspectives and practices. The French & Italian studies combined major enables advanced language study in both tongues while exploring the deep historical, linguistic, and cultural ties between Italy, France, and Francophone regions. The curriculum integrates essential courses from both French and Italian BA programs, supplemented by electives in each discipline and two cross-cultural comparison courses. Students develop robust abilities in communication, writing, speaking, and analytical reasoning. As part of a liberal arts education, this program equips graduates with valuable practical skills and enhanced intercultural competence.
Student are required to have a high school graduation
English Language Proficiency Requirements: TOEFL iBT – 79; IELTS Academic – 6.5; Pearson Test of Academic English (PTE Academic) – 59; Cambridge Assessment English (CAE) C1 Advanced – 180.
Application Deadline for Fall: For freshmen international students the deadlines are November 1 (early action 1 deadline), December 1 (early action 2 deadline) and January 1 (regular deadline)
